What is a movie writer?

A Movie Writer, also known as a screenwriter, is responsible for creating the script for a film. They develop the story, characters, and dialogue while shaping the narrative structure. Movie Writers often collaborate with directors, producers, and studios to refine their script to fit the vision of the project. Their work can involve original ideas or adaptations from books, plays, or real-life events. Successful screenwriting requires creativity, storytelling skills, and an understanding of cinematic techniques.

How does a movie writer typically collaborate with other members of a film production team?

Movie Writers frequently work closely with directors, producers, and development executives to refine and adapt scripts throughout the pre-production process. This collaboration may involve participating in story meetings, incorporating notes, and making revisions to align the screenplay with creative and budgetary requirements. Effective communication and openness to feedback are essential, as scripts often evolve based on input from various stakeholders. Being able to work as part of a creative team not only enhances the final product but also fosters valuable professional relationships that can lead to future op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the movie writer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Movie Writer, you need exceptional storytelling ability, creativity, and a strong grasp of screenplay structure, often demonstrated through a portfolio or formal training in screenwriting or film studies. Familiarity with industry-standard screenwriting software such as Final Draft or Celtx is important, and some writers may benefit from certifications or workshops offered by film organizations. Excellent communication, resilience to feedback, and the ability to collaborate effectively with directors, producers, and other creatives are key soft skills. These competencies ensure that a Movie Writer can craft compelling scripts that resonate with audiences and adapt to the demands of the film industry.
